Action item from the Saltmarsh incident: the validator plugin loader retried failing plugins forever and starved the queue. We're adding a retry cap plus an exponential backoff, and quarantining plugins that keep crashing. Nothing fancy, but it should stop a single bad validator from taking the pipeline down again. For the release notes, these are the new defaults.

tuning constants:
QUOTAS = {
    "kasok": 171,
    "sormir": 144,
}

Welcome to on-call for the Glimmerpane design system! Our snapshot tests live in the `snapcheck` suite and run on every merge to main. If a UI component changes visually, the diff bot flags it — usually it's an intentional tweak, so just approve the new baseline. If it's 2am and snapshots are failing across the board, it's almost always a font-loading race, not your problem. To unlock the baseline store and re-approve snapshots in bulk, use the recovery passphrase below.

recovery phrase for tahag-taguf: wenix-caswyn

### Step 2: Deploy the new reset flow

The revamped password reset flow in Gatewren replaces emailed links with short-lived codes. Before enabling it, verify the old link handler still accepts in-flight tokens for 48 hours, or users mid-reset will be stranded. Enable the feature flag only after the code service passes its health check. The reset service reads the configuration values below at startup.

deployment values, fahap-hahaf:
[casdor]
port = 9200
region = south-2
host = casdor.qirvanworks.corp
timeout_ms = 3000
retries = 4

## Changelog — DeployPing Bot v2.4

Renamed setting: `STATUS_CHANNEL_KEY` is now `DEPLOY_STATUS_TOKEN`. Old name is ignored as of this release — update your local env files or the bot silently skips status posts.

New team members: copy `.env.example`, rename the variable, then add the token on the next line.

sealed setting: VAULT_KEY3=eec

## Runbook: Skylark Crash-Report Pipeline

Crash reports from the Skylark mobile client land in the intake queue, are symbolicated by the Dapple worker pool, then grouped into issues. If symbolication stalls, check that the matching symbol bundle was uploaded for the release; missing bundles are the most common failure. Drain and requeue unsymbolicated reports only after the bundle is present. When paging the on-call, always attach the pipeline trace token printed below this line.

pipeline stamp: htk4_ae36